Java Spring Boot 2.0实战Redis分布式缓存与底层API架构

本文涉及的产品
云数据库 Redis 版,社区版 2GB
推荐场景:
搭建游戏排行榜
简介: 《阿里巴巴Java Spring Boot 2.0开发实战课程》10课:Java Spring Boot 2.0实战Redis分布式缓存与底层API架构 本期分享专家:徐雷—阿里巴巴云栖Java讲师,MongoDB讲师 本期分享主题:Java Spring Boot 2.

《阿里巴巴Java Spring Boot 2.0开发实战课程》10课
本期分享专家:徐雷—阿里巴巴云栖Java讲师,MongoDB讲师

本期分享主题:Java Spring Boot 2.0实战Redis分布式缓存与底层API架构(面试题)

4c712907f505c1126d764d234737a2b45934bf02
内容概要:Redis分布式高并发缓存,高并发架构的必备技术!BAT等一线互联网名企面试必备,

本课程讲解如何使用最新的Java Spring Data  2.0 实战Redis,以及底层API的实现源码。

1.Java Spring Data Redis的新特性:
1. 支持 多种 Redis 驱动程序 / 连接器的低级抽象( Jedis Lettuce JRedis SRP 过期)
2. Spring Data Access exception Redis driver exceptions 转换
3. RedisTemplate 供高级抽象 封装 行各种 Redis 操作,异常转换和序列 工作
4. Pubsub 发布订阅模式支 持(例如消息驱动的 POJO MessageListenerContainer
5. Redis Sentinel Redis Cluster 集群模式
6. JDK String JSON Spring Object / XML 映射序列化器
7. 基于 Redis JDK Collection 实现
8. Atomic counter 子计数器支 持,提供工具类型
9. Sorting and Pipelining
10. API SORT SORT / GET 模式和返回 的批 值数据
11. Redis 实现了 Spring 3.1 缓存抽象
12. 自动实现 Repository 接口,包括使用 @ EnableRedisRepositories 支持自定义查找程序方法

13. CDI 对存储库的支持

2.Linux安装Redis
d0f24a7ce00de4b76c3e9535e00c6b38847749f7

视频地址:https://yq.aliyun.com/live/791

PPT地址:https://yq.aliyun.com/download/3265

PS:阿里巴巴Java学习进阶大群”千人大群
直播地址:Java技术进阶群
进群方式:钉钉扫码入群
C926B5D9_9BC2_4452_B14E_7F2F506EDAF9

相关实践学习
基于Redis实现在线游戏积分排行榜
本场景将介绍如何基于Redis数据库实现在线游戏中的游戏玩家积分排行榜功能。
云数据库 Redis 版使用教程
云数据库Redis版是兼容Redis协议标准的、提供持久化的内存数据库服务,基于高可靠双机热备架构及可无缝扩展的集群架构,满足高读写性能场景及容量需弹性变配的业务需求。 产品详情:https://www.aliyun.com/product/kvstore     ------------------------------------------------------------------------- 阿里云数据库体验:数据库上云实战 开发者云会免费提供一台带自建MySQL的源数据库 ECS 实例和一台目标数据库 RDS实例。跟着指引,您可以一步步实现将ECS自建数据库迁移到目标数据库RDS。 点击下方链接,领取免费ECS&RDS资源,30分钟完成数据库上云实战!https://developer.aliyun.com/adc/scenario/51eefbd1894e42f6bb9acacadd3f9121?spm=a2c6h.13788135.J_3257954370.9.4ba85f24utseFl
目录
相关文章
|
4天前
|
安全 Java API
第7章 Spring Security 的 REST API 与微服务安全(2024 最新版)(上)
第7章 Spring Security 的 REST API 与微服务安全(2024 最新版)
23 0
第7章 Spring Security 的 REST API 与微服务安全(2024 最新版)(上)
|
22天前
|
NoSQL Java Redis
SpringBoot集成Redis解决表单重复提交接口幂等(亲测可用)
SpringBoot集成Redis解决表单重复提交接口幂等(亲测可用)
73 0
|
14小时前
|
存储 缓存 运维
软件体系结构 - 缓存技术(5)Redis Cluster
【4月更文挑战第20天】软件体系结构 - 缓存技术(5)Redis Cluster
28 10
|
4天前
|
Java API Apache
ZooKeeper【基础 03】Java 客户端 Apache Curator 基础 API 使用举例(含源代码)
【4月更文挑战第11天】ZooKeeper【基础 03】Java 客户端 Apache Curator 基础 API 使用举例(含源代码)
22 11
|
5天前
|
安全 Java API
java借助代理ip,解决访问api频繁导致ip被禁的问题
java借助代理ip,解决访问api频繁导致ip被禁的问题
|
5天前
|
NoSQL 数据可视化 Java
Springboot整合redis
Springboot整合redis
|
6天前
|
人工智能 前端开发 Java
Java语言开发的AI智慧导诊系统源码springboot+redis 3D互联网智导诊系统源码
智慧导诊解决盲目就诊问题,减轻分诊工作压力。降低挂错号比例,优化就诊流程,有效提高线上线下医疗机构接诊效率。可通过人体画像选择症状部位,了解对应病症信息和推荐就医科室。
48 10
|
8天前
|
存储 安全 Java
说说Java 8 引入的Stream API
说说Java 8 引入的Stream API
10 0
|
8天前
|
缓存 NoSQL Java
使用Redis进行Java缓存策略设计
【4月更文挑战第16天】在高并发Java应用中,Redis作为缓存中间件提升性能。本文探讨如何使用Redis设计缓存策略。Redis是开源内存数据结构存储系统,支持多种数据结构。Java中常用Redis客户端有Jedis和Lettuce。缓存设计遵循一致性、失效、雪崩、穿透和预热原则。常见缓存模式包括Cache-Aside、Read-Through、Write-Through和Write-Behind。示例展示了使用Jedis实现Cache-Aside模式。优化策略包括分布式锁、缓存预热、随机过期时间、限流和降级,以应对缓存挑战。
|
8天前
|
分布式计算 Java API
Java 8新特性之Lambda表达式与Stream API
【4月更文挑战第16天】本文将介绍Java 8中的两个重要新特性:Lambda表达式和Stream API。Lambda表达式是Java 8中引入的一种新的编程语法,它允许我们将函数作为参数传递给其他方法,从而使代码更加简洁、易读。Stream API是Java 8中引入的一种新的数据处理方式,它允许我们以声明式的方式处理数据,从而使代码更加简洁、高效。本文将通过实例代码详细讲解这两个新特性的使用方法和优势。